Description Human Resources Specialist (Spanish-Speaking) Sunrise, FL Position Type: Full-Time, On-Site Job Summary We are seeking a dynamic and highly skilled Human Resources Specialist to join our client. This position is an integral part of our organization and will support a workforce of 100 employees. The ideal candidate will have 3-5 years of experience in human resources, be fluent in Spanish, and have proficiency in ADP Workforce Now software. As the sole HR professional in the facility, you will be responsible for overseeing the day-to-day HR operations, ensuring compliance with policies and regulations, and supporting the well-being of employees. Key Responsibilities Employee Relations & Support: Serve as the primary point of contact for employee inquiries and concerns. Assist with resolving conflicts, addressing grievances, and fostering a positive work environment. Provide guidance to employees on company policies and procedures in both English and Spanish. Recruitment & Onboarding: Manage the full-cycle recruitment process, including job postings, candidate sourcing, conducting interviews, and hiring for various positions. Oversee the onboarding process, ensuring a smooth transition for new hires, including facilitating orientation and necessary training. Payroll & Benefits Administration: Process payroll using ADP Workforce Now software, ensuring accuracy and timely distribution. Administer employee benefits programs, including health, dental, and retirement plans, and answer questions regarding benefits enrollment and eligibility. Compliance & Recordkeeping: Ensure compliance with federal, state, and local employment laws and regulations. Maintain and update employee records, ensuring confidentiality and accuracy in line with company policies. Assist with audits and ensure proper documentation for HR-related activities. Training & Development: Coordinate employee training programs, ensuring all employees meet compliance requirements and receive necessary professional development. Assist with performance management, evaluations, and growth opportunities. Experience 3-5 years of experience as an HR professional, with a solid understanding of HR principles, practices, and regulations. Experience managing HR processes in a standalone HR role is a plus. Language Skills Fluency in Spanish (written and spoken) is required to communicate effectively with all employees. Software Skills Proficiency with ADP Workforce Now software for payroll processing, reporting, and employee data management. Education Bachelor’s degree in Human Resources, Business Administration, or a related field preferred, but not required. Knowledge & Skills Strong knowledge of HR best practices, employment laws, and regulations. Excellent communication and interpersonal skills. Ability to work independently and manage multiple tasks in a fast-paced environment. Strong attention to detail and organizational skills.
